public class LockInfo
extends Object
Information about a lock. A lock can be a built-in object monitor, an ownable synchronizer, or the Condition object associated with synchronizers.
An ownable synchronizer is a synchronizer that may be exclusively owned by a thread and uses AbstractOwnableSynchronizer (or its subclass) to implement its synchronization property. ReentrantLock and the write-lock (but not the read-lock) of ReentrantReadWriteLock are two examples of ownable synchronizers provided by the platform.
MXBean Mapping
LockInfo is mapped to a CompositeData as specified in the from method.

Constructors
LockInfo
public LockInfo(String className,
int identityHashCode)
Constructs a LockInfo object.
- Parameters:
className- the fully qualified name of the class of the lock object.identityHashCode- theidentity hash codeof the lock object.

getIdentityHashCode
public int getIdentityHashCode()
Returns the identity hash code of the lock object returned from the System.identityHashCode(java.lang.Object) method.
- Returns:
- the identity hash code of the lock object.
from
public static LockInfo from(CompositeData cd)
Returns a LockInfo object represented by the given CompositeData. The given CompositeData must contain the following attributes:
| Attribute Name | Type |
|---|---|
| className | java.lang.String |
| identityHashCode | java.lang.Integer |

toString
public String toString()
Returns a string representation of a lock. The returned string representation consists of the name of the class of the lock object, the at-sign character `@', and the unsigned hexadecimal representation of the identity hash code of the object. This method returns a string equals to the value of:
lock.getClass().getName() + '@' + Integer.toHexString(System.identityHashCode(lock)) where lock is the lock object.
